General Information about #282CA6
The hex color #282CA6, also known as Governor Bay, is a deep, muted shade of blue-violet. In the RGB color model, it is composed of 15.69% red, 17.25% green, and 65.1% blue. This color is often associated with qualities such as trust, stability, and intelligence, making it a popular choice for brands and organizations that wish to project a sense of reliability and professionalism. Its depth and richness can also evoke feelings of sophistication and elegance. Governor Bay sits comfortably between blue and violet, incorporating characteristics of both hues. In design applications, it can provide a calming and grounding presence while adding a touch of refinement.
The color #282CA6, also known as Governor Bay, presents several accessibility considerations for web developers. Its relative luminance is quite low, meaning that text rendered in this color on a white background (or vice versa) may not provide sufficient contrast for users with visual impairments. According to WCAG guidelines, the contrast ratio between text and background should be at least 4.5:1 for normal text and 3:1 for large text. It's crucial to test this color with an accessibility checker to ensure compliance. When using Governor Bay for text, consider pairing it with a very light color like white or a very pale yellow to achieve the required contrast ratio. Avoid using it for crucial UI elements if sufficient contrast cannot be guaranteed. Furthermore, consider providing alternative color schemes to allow users to customize their experience based on their visual needs, thereby enhancing overall usability.

Website Design
Governor Bay can be used as an accent color in website designs for tech companies or educational institutions to convey trust, intelligence, and innovation. It can be applied in headers, buttons, and link highlights to draw attention without being too overpowering. Its depth makes it suitable for data visualizations, charts, and graphs, allowing for clear differentiation and readability. Furthermore, it can be incorporated into loading screens and subtle animations, creating a sense of professionalism and reliability.
Fashion Design
In fashion, Governor Bay can be used in clothing and accessories to convey sophistication and elegance. It can be a base color for formal wear such as suits and dresses, or an accent color in scarves, ties, and handbags. Its versatility allows it to pair well with both neutral colors like gray and beige, as well as more vibrant colors like coral and gold, making it suitable for a wide range of styles and occasions. The color can be used in patterns as well as block colors.
Interior Design
In interior design, Governor Bay can be used to create a calming and sophisticated atmosphere in bedrooms, studies, or living rooms. It can be applied on walls as an accent color, or used in furniture upholstery and decorative elements such as cushions, curtains, and rugs. It pairs well with neutral tones like white, gray, and beige, as well as natural materials like wood and stone. The color can also be combined with metallic accents like gold and silver for a touch of luxury.
